Angle Converter
Convert angle measurements between Radians, Milliradians, Degrees, Minutes of Arc, Seconds of Arc, Gradians, Revolutions, Circles and Mils.
Angle Unit Conversion Table
| 1 unit = | Radian (rad) | Milliradian (mrad) | Degree (°) | Minute of Arc (arcmin) | Second of Arc (arcsec) | Gradian (gon) | Revolution | Circle | Mil |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Radian (rad) | 1 | 1000 | 57.2957795131 | 3437.74677078 | 206264.806247 | 63.6619772368 | 0.159154943092 | 0.159154943092 | 1018.59163579 |
| Milliradian (mrad) | 0.001 | 1 | 0.0572957795131 | 3.43774677078 | 206.264806247 | 0.0636619772368 | 0.000159154943092 | 0.000159154943092 | 1.01859163579 |
| Degree (°) | 0.0174532925199 | 17.4532925199 | 1 | 60 | 3600 | 1.11111111111 | 0.00277777777778 | 0.00277777777778 | 17.7777777778 |
| Minute of Arc (arcmin) | 0.000290888208666 | 0.290888208666 | 0.0166666666667 | 1 | 60 | 0.0185185185185 | 0.0000462962962963 | 0.0000462962962963 | 0.296296296296 |
| Second of Arc (arcsec) | 0.0000048481368111 | 0.0048481368111 | 0.000277777777778 | 0.0166666666667 | 1 | 0.000308641975309 | 7.71604938272e-7 | 7.71604938272e-7 | 0.00493827160494 |
| Gradian (gon) | 0.0157079632679 | 15.7079632679 | 0.9 | 54 | 3240 | 1 | 0.0025 | 0.0025 | 16 |
| Revolution | 6.28318530718 | 6283.18530718 | 360 | 21600 | 1296000 | 400 | 1 | 1 | 6400 |
| Circle | 6.28318530718 | 6283.18530718 | 360 | 21600 | 1296000 | 400 | 1 | 1 | 6400 |
| Mil | 0.000981747704247 | 0.981747704247 | 0.05625 | 3.375 | 202.5 | 0.0625 | 0.00015625 | 0.00015625 | 1 |

What is an Angle Converter?
An Angle Converter is a tool that allows you to convert between different units of angular measurement. Angles are fundamental in various fields, including mathematics, physics, engineering, and navigation. This tool simplifies the process of translating a value from one unit (like degrees) to another (like radians).
